How can I buy tickets for events at Fallsview Casino?

Tickets for events at Fallsview Casino are available through the official casino website. You can browse upcoming shows, concerts, and special events, then select your preferred date and seating section. After choosing your tickets, you’ll be directed to a secure checkout page where you can enter payment details. Once the purchase is complete, your tickets will be sent to the email address provided. It’s recommended to check your inbox and spam folder in case the confirmation email doesn’t appear right away. For events with high demand, tickets may sell out quickly, so it’s best to purchase in advance.

Can I get a refund if I can’t attend a ticketed event at Fallsview Casino?

Refunds for Fallsview Casino tickets are generally not available once a purchase is made. The policy is set by the event organizer and is clearly stated during the checkout process. If a show is canceled or rescheduled, the casino will contact ticket holders with details about new dates or refund options. In cases of cancellation due to unforeseen circumstances, refunds may be issued through the original payment method. It’s important to review the event’s terms and conditions before buying, as most tickets are final sale. For future events, consider purchasing insurance or choosing flexible ticket types if they are offered.

What should I bring with me when I go to a ticketed event at Fallsview Casino?

When attending a ticketed event at Fallsview Casino, bring your printed or digital ticket, a valid government-issued photo ID, and any required access passes if you are part of a group or have special seating. If you plan to eat or drink during the event, check if outside food or beverages are allowed, as policies vary. Wear comfortable clothing and shoes, especially if you’ll be standing or walking through the venue. Arrive early to allow time for security screening and finding your seat. Avoid bringing large bags or prohibited items, which may be subject to inspection or denied entry.
